美国服务器VPS怎么防御CC攻击
随着互联网的普及和发展,网络攻击已经成为了一个不容忽视的问题,CC攻击(Challenge Collapsar)是一种常见的DDoS攻击手段,通过大量伪造请求消耗服务器资源,导致正常用户无法访问,对于使用美国服务器VPS的用户来说,如何有效地防御CC攻击是一个亟待解决的问题,本文将详细介绍美国服务器VPS如何防御CC攻击的方法。
1、了解CC攻击原理
CC攻击的原理是通过模拟大量用户(通常是肉鸡)对目标服务器发起大量的请求,消耗服务器的资源,导致正常用户无法访问,这种攻击通常针对的是Web应用,尤其是那些需要用户登录的网站,攻击者通过分析网站的登录机制,构造大量的恶意请求,使得服务器在处理这些请求时消耗大量的CPU、内存等资源,从而导致正常用户无法访问。
2、选择高性能的美国服务器VPS
选择高性能的美国服务器VPS是防御CC攻击的基础,高性能的服务器可以在短时间内处理大量的请求,从而降低被攻击的风险,在选择美国服务器VPS时,可以从以下几个方面进行考虑:
CPU性能:选择具有较高主频和多核心的CPU,可以提高服务器的处理能力。
内存大小:内存越大,服务器处理请求的能力越强,建议选择至少2GB以上的内存。
带宽大小:足够的带宽可以保证服务器在面对大量请求时,仍能保持稳定的运行速度,建议选择100Mbps以上的带宽。
硬盘性能:选择SSD硬盘,可以提高服务器的读写速度,从而提高处理请求的效率。
3、安装防火墙和安全软件
安装防火墙和安全软件可以帮助美国服务器VPS抵御CC攻击,防火墙可以过滤掉恶意的请求,保护服务器免受攻击,安全软件可以检测到异常的流量,及时发出警报,提醒管理员采取措施,常用的防火墙有iptables、firewalld等,常用的安全软件有ModSecurity、Fail2ban等。
4、限制IP访问频率
限制IP访问频率是防御CC攻击的有效方法,通过限制单个IP在一定时间内的访问次数,可以防止恶意用户通过大量请求消耗服务器资源,可以使用Nginx、Apache等Web服务器的配置来实现这一功能,在Nginx中,可以通过设置limit_req模块来限制IP访问频率:
http {
limit_req_zone $binary_remote_addr zone=one:10m rate=1r/s;
...
server {
...
location / {
limit_req zone=one burst=5 nodelay;
...
}
}
5、使用CDN服务
使用CDN服务可以将网站的静态资源分发到全球多个节点,当遭受CC攻击时,攻击流量会被分散到各个节点,从而降低单个节点的压力,CDN服务通常会提供一定程度的DDoS防护功能,可以进一步提高服务器的安全性,常用的CDN服务提供商有Cloudflare、Akamai等。
6、启用HTTPS协议
启用HTTPS协议可以防止中间人攻击,提高数据传输的安全性,HTTPS协议会对传输的数据进行加密,使得攻击者难以分析和篡改数据,要启用HTTPS协议,需要为网站配置SSL证书,可以选择免费的Let's Encrypt证书,或者购买付费的证书。
7、保持系统和软件更新
保持系统和软件更新可以修复已知的安全漏洞,提高服务器的安全性,定期检查并更新操作系统、Web服务器、数据库等软件,确保它们都是最新版本,关注安全公告,了解最新的安全威胁和防护措施。
8、建立应急响应机制
建立应急响应机制可以在遭受CC攻击时,迅速采取措施,减少损失,制定详细的应急预案,包括监控、报警、处理等环节,定期进行应急演练,提高应对突发事件的能力。
防御CC攻击需要从多个方面进行综合考虑,包括选择高性能的美国服务器VPS、安装防火墙和安全软件、限制IP访问频率、使用CDN服务、启用HTTPS协议、保持系统和软件更新以及建立应急响应机制等,通过这些措施,可以有效地提高美国服务器VPS的安全性,抵御CC攻击。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/151763.html